Transfer bar heat loss has long been a challenge for hot strip mill operators. Heat is lost through conduction, convection, and radiation, leading to uneven temperatures along the transfer bar during rolling. To address this, operators increased rolling loads and power levels in the finishing mill. However, with rising energy costs and the global push to reduce CO2 emissions, it became the perfect time for steel producers to invest in technology that helps retain heat in the transfer bar. This technology reduces the need for higher rolling loads and power, cutting energy consumption and costs. It also allows for higher speeds in the finishing mill, improving throughput, ensuring more consistent dimensional tolerances, reducing edge cracking, and preventing surface defects.
